区块链钱包地址算法解析:如何生成安全可靠的

              <abbr dropzone="rwugi8"></abbr><big id="w5j79k"></big><kbd lang="ik0z8y"></kbd><abbr lang="6jkq48"></abbr><strong draggable="brkplr"></strong><small date-time="66h2b6"></small><address draggable="3v6c8o"></address><u dropzone="tayt7g"></u><small dropzone="7x8lsu"></small><em date-time="yxwkvr"></em><ul date-time="9gm0qf"></ul><acronym draggable="mfppbd"></acronym><font draggable="fd2x7g"></font><small lang="xoojdy"></small><acronym date-time="vs57ou"></acronym><em date-time="nv4r1l"></em><dfn draggable="mqay8l"></dfn><strong dir="ntbx0z"></strong><tt dir="zekau1"></tt><abbr lang="_sk8_0"></abbr><style date-time="eetvud"></style><sub id="mqb0_u"></sub><time draggable="06ohgr"></time><em draggable="4xf9lw"></em><pre dropzone="9ich7d"></pre><ol dir="wbzee8"></ol><legend id="c2qjru"></legend><legend draggable="3pk8cc"></legend><i lang="kf4dba"></i><var date-time="9vm_yx"></var><code draggable="6kbula"></code><i dir="fwt0d4"></i><dl lang="dbq553"></dl><strong id="u9jtrz"></strong><var lang="_nz__t"></var><abbr date-time="ser3zt"></abbr><noframes date-time="02ly4l">
                                发布时间:2024-11-30 15:33:56

                                区块链技术的快速发展使得数字货币的使用愈发普及,钱包地址作为数字资产的“家”,扮演着至关重要的角色。理解钱包地址的生成算法,不仅对开发者重要,对普通用户来说也是提升安全意识的必要课程。本文将深入探讨区块链钱包地址的生成算法,包括如何生成安全的钱包地址,钱包地址的类型及其特点,以及这一过程背后的技术原理。

                                一、区块链钱包地址概述

                                区块链钱包是存储数字货币的工具,它包含了一对密钥:公钥和私钥。公钥类似于银行账号,用户可以通过这个地址接收数字货币;而私钥则是用来签名交易的重要凭证,只有拥有私钥的人才能使用相应的数字资产。因此,钱包地址的安全性与生成算法息息相关。

                                二、钱包地址的生成算法

                                钱包地址的生成一般经过几个步骤,包括密钥对生成、哈希值计算以及地址编码等。下面我们来详细解读这些步骤:

                                1. **密钥对生成**:在比特币等主流区块链中,使用椭圆曲线加密算法(ECDSA)生成一对密钥。这一过程通常涉及随机数生成和曲线计算,以确保生成的私钥是随机且不可预测的。私钥是一个256位的数字,而公钥则是通过椭圆曲线算法计算得出的。

                                2. **生成哈希值**:公钥生成后,接下来会进行多次哈希计算以生成最终的钱包地址。通常使用SHA-256和RIPEMD-160两种哈希算法,首先对公钥进行SHA-256哈希处理,再进行RIPEMD-160哈希处理,得到一个160位的哈希值,这就是所谓的公钥哈希值。

                                3. **地址编码**:最后一步是将公钥哈希值转化为常用的钱包地址格式,例如Base58Check编码。这个过程会包括添加网络标识符、校验和等,以确保钱包地址的有效性和可读性。生成的钱包地址根据不同的区块链可能会有所不同,但一般来说,都会有前缀来指示网络类型(如比特币的1或3开头)。

                                三、钱包地址的类型

                                在不同的区块链网络中,钱包地址存在多种类型。以下是一些常见的钱包地址类型:

                                1. **比特币(BTC)地址**:比特币地址有三种主要格式,包括传统的P2PKH(以数字1开头)、P2SH(以数字3开头)和SegWit(以字母bc1开头的Bech32格式)。

                                2. **以太坊(ETH)地址**:以太坊地址通常以“0x”开头,总长度为40个十六进制字符。例如0x1234567890abcdef1234567890abcdef12345678。

                                3. **莱特币(LTC)地址**:莱特币地址与比特币相似,主要包括以L或者M开头的P2PKH地址和以3开头的P2SH地址。

                                4. **其他区块链**:许多其他区块链(如瑞波(XRP)、币安币(BNB)等)都有各自的地址格式和生成算法。因此,在进行跨链交易时,用户需特别注意地址匹配。

                                四、钱包地址的安全性

                                钱包地址的安全性对数字资产的保护至关重要。以下是一些提升钱包地址安全性的措施:

                                1. **使用强密码**:在生成私钥时,推荐使用强随机数生成器,并定期更换密码,避免因简单密码被破解。

                                2. **冷钱包存储**:长期持有数字资产时,最好将其存储在冷钱包(即离线钱包)中,避免因网络攻击导致资产损失。

                                3. **多重签名钱包**:使用多重签名技术,可以为钱包增加额外的安全层,要求多个私钥共同签名后才能完成交易。这能在一定程度上防止单点故障。

                                五、常见问题解答

                                Q1:如何安全存储我的私钥?

                                私钥是访问您的数字资产的唯一凭证,安全存储私钥至关重要。您可以采取以下措施增强私钥的安全性:

                                1. **使用硬件钱包**:硬件钱包是存储私钥的物理设备,能够有效避免网络攻击和病毒的风险。选择知名品牌的硬件钱包,可以提供较高的安全保障。

                                2. **纸质备份**:可以将私钥打印或手工抄写在纸上,存储在安全的地方,如保险箱等,避免数字化存储可能带来的风险。

                                3. **加密存储**:如果必须以电子形式存储私钥,务必使用成熟的加密工具进行加密,并定期更新密码.

                                Q2:钱包地址会被盗吗?如何避免?

                                钱包地址本身不会被盗,盗窃发生的原因通常是私钥的泄露。所以,保护好您的私钥是防止资产盗窃的关键。以下是一些建议:

                                1. **定期更新软件**:使用最新版的数字钱包软件,确保所有安全漏洞都被修复。

                                2. **谨慎点击链接**:避免访问不明来源的网址和下载未知的应用程序,以免被钓鱼网站或恶意软件钓走私钥。

                                3. **启用双重身份验证**:在支持的情况下启用双重身份验证,增加额外的安全围栏。

                                Q3:钱包地址可以更改吗?

                                钱包地址本身不可以更改,但是您可以随时生成新的钱包地址。每次生成的新地址都是独一无二的,适用于新的交易。以下是提高隐私的方法:

                                1. **定期更新地址**:在每次接收资金时使用新创建的地址,这样可以增强交易的隐私性,避免链上账户追踪.

                                2. **使用隐私币**:某些加密货币,如门罗币(XMR),通过技术手段提高隐私性,生成的交易较难被追踪。

                                Q4:为什么有些地址可以接收多个币?

                                部分区块链钱包可以生成支持多链的地址。这是因为这些钱包通常采用标准化协议或技术,如HD钱包协议。HD钱包能够从单一私钥派生出多个子私钥和地址,适用于多种数字货币。

                                通过这种方式,用户只需记住一个主私钥,就能够管理和接收不同数字资产。这种便利性促进了用户体验,但也要注意保持主私钥的安全。

                                Q5:如何检查钱包地址的有效性?

                                验证钱包地址的有效性,可以通过如下步骤进行:

                                1. **格式检查**:校验地址长度、字符,包括前缀是否合法。

                                2. **校验和验证**:大多数加密货币的钱包地址在生成时会计算校验和,确保输入的地址是正确的。例如,比特币地址的最后几位字符就是校验和,可以用来计算和验证。

                                3. **使用第三方工具**:有一些在线工具可以用来检查地址的有效性与是否为可用状态。

                                Q6:如何选择合适的钱包?

                                选择合适的钱包涉及多个因素,包括安全性、易用性、支持的币种等。为了更好的选择,您可以考虑如下方面:

                                1. **安全性**:优先选择那些经过验证的、高评测分的钱包,确保其具备多重签名、更改备份及加密存储等安全特性。

                                2. **使用便捷性**:选择界面友好的钱包,且易于进行交易和管理资产,同时支持多链钱包也会更方便。

                                3. **社区与支持**:了解该钱包的社区活跃度及开发者支持情况,及时跟进软件更新与漏洞修复。

                                通过上述内容的学习,对区块链钱包地址的生成算法及相关问题有了更深入的了解。安全和知识是保护自己的最佳方式,保持警惕,将为您的数字资产保驾护航。

                                分享 :
                                                author

                                                tpwallet

                                                T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                                        相关新闻

                                                        tpWallet价格显示不对的原因
                                                        2024-11-21
                                                        tpWallet价格显示不对的原因

                                                        tpWallet是一款广受欢迎的数字货币钱包,它支持多种数字资产的管理与交易。然而,许多用户在使用过程中发现,tp...

                                                        详解如何在tpWallet上购买合
                                                        2025-01-06
                                                        详解如何在tpWallet上购买合

                                                        随着区块链技术的不断发展,数字货币市场吸引了越来越多的投资者。而合约币作为数字货币的一种,凭借其杠杆交...

                                                        如何通过tpWallet购买HTMoo
                                                        2025-01-27
                                                        如何通过tpWallet购买HTMoo

                                                        随着区块链技术的迅猛发展,越来越多的用户开始关注和投资各种数字货币。HTMoon作为一种新兴的加密货币,受到了...

                                                        如何选择适合自己的数字
                                                        2025-02-13
                                                        如何选择适合自己的数字

                                                        在如今数字货币迅速发展的时代,越来越多的人开始关注并使用数字货币钱包。数字货币钱包不仅是存储加密货币的...

                                                                            <area lang="fh2emkq"></area><strong date-time="zwxss6e"></strong><abbr dir="4_2om9w"></abbr><address lang="syyd_t6"></address><map id="2p8qy5d"></map><ol id="35gosxz"></ol><noscript lang="gt71q76"></noscript><address id="fvwxofn"></address><acronym id="u280exu"></acronym><em lang="qk0bnnh"></em><b dir="8p38y6t"></b><pre dropzone="bk2hm4l"></pre><del draggable="vvn1yb6"></del><u dir="5iedbyn"></u><kbd draggable="4wcl7b2"></kbd><map id="cn4o46f"></map><strong draggable="gepmc6y"></strong><noscript draggable="bfhkhce"></noscript><u id="ldobbfq"></u><kbd lang="mmyciuz"></kbd><kbd id="rh_rbkm"></kbd><tt dropzone="_noukfo"></tt><address lang="eypts0q"></address><small date-time="100xpji"></small><i date-time="mqsetep"></i><tt id="ebi10ad"></tt><strong id="j36xbnu"></strong><font dropzone="1kiozd1"></font><code draggable="og1hqn5"></code><pre dir="ojrfpr2"></pre><bdo dropzone="j8ji6k2"></bdo><em lang="jf4l56p"></em><abbr dir="pmosxo1"></abbr><strong dir="k8idhs8"></strong><em lang="diewj6w"></em><u id="z6wgubg"></u><font draggable="66onamr"></font><abbr lang="ffr0i8_"></abbr><code date-time="q6jofm5"></code><noscript lang="odd8wdq"></noscript><noscript draggable="63h36pt"></noscript><bdo lang="qg3zqo6"></bdo><pre id="4y0npfy"></pre><code id="hslkpy4"></code><font lang="e859jyx"></font><var date-time="k_vs7ff"></var><del id="yyyfy_j"></del><code date-time="lqjazvj"></code><noscript lang="yuo90px"></noscript><tt lang="l56zi09"></tt><u id="gi2u724"></u><noframes dir="bryvsao">

                                                                                                标签